New Delhi: Kannada actor-director Rishabh Shetty’s film ‘Kantara’ has broken all records at the box office. His popularity has skyrocketed with the massive success of the film which is still ruling the box office even after one month of its release. Rishabh who has been traveling to various places for the promotional campaign across the nation met South African cricketer and Royal Challengers Bangalore star AB de Villiers, on Thursday.
Rishabh Shetty took to his Instagram account to share a video with AB de Villiers, where he is seen giving a shout-out to Kantara. “It’s a Match! Met the real 360 today. The Superhero is back to the roots again to #NammaBengaluru," Rishabh captioned the video.
Seeing the post, fans couldn’t keep calm seeing their favourite stars together and flooded the comment section with comments. For the unversed, In November 2021, AB de Villiers announced his retirement from all formats of cricket.

Rishab Shetty's 'Kantara' has been doing exceptionally well at the box office ever since it released on September 30. The Kannada film has grossed over Rs. 300 crores globally till now and has earned its name as the highest-grosser of the year.
